Any boxing fans here?
What the hell happened to professional boxing?
I'm 38 years old,,, I missed the great era of heavyweights but I was a teen when the awesome middle/welter/light-heavyweight battles were fought (Duran, Leonard, Hagler, Hearns). Anyone else remember Hearns v Hagler? The Duran v Leonard fights? If you don't,, take it from me, they were incredible. Back then, boxing was big,, real big,, the talk of bars and watercoolers around the world. Everyone knew who the pugilists were in the next big fight. It was awesome,,, seems folk got much more fired-up about those bouts than almost any other sporting event. Then we had the Mike Tyson Era,, which was great,,,, then it all just died. Was it the move to pay-per-view from Network TV that killed it? Or was it the infinate number of different governing bodies that sprang-up? (IBF,WBA,WBC,IBO,WBO etc etc). Or what? Apart from the occasional little distraction like Nigel Benn, Camacho, Naseem Hamed or De La Hoya in the last 10 years,,, noone seems to make the headlines anymore,,, I couldn't tell you the name of one current championship-holding boxer. OK,, rant over. I miss those big fights. |
